Sand Casting: Applications and strategies
Among the different techniques used in aluminum casting, sand casting sticks out due to its versatility and cost-effectiveness. This technique involves creating a mold and mildew from a combination of sand and binder, which can be formed to accommodate complex styles. Once the mold is prepared, liquified aluminum is put right into it, permitting detailed attributes and details to be recorded.
Sand casting is particularly useful for generating large parts and low-volume manufacturing runs, making it suitable for vehicle components, machinery components, and imaginative sculptures. The technique additionally suits a series of aluminum alloys, improving its versatility in different applications. Furthermore, the use of sand as a mold and mildew material enables very easy improvement and reuse, adding to eco lasting methods. Achieving high dimensional accuracy can present obstacles, necessitating competent workmanship and careful control of the casting process. On the whole, sand casting remains a basic approach in aluminum foundries worldwide.
Die Casting: Precision and Performance
Die casting is a very efficient approach of generating aluminum elements with phenomenal dimensional accuracy and surface area finish. This process involves forcing liquified aluminum into a precisely machined mold under high stress, which permits intricate designs and very little material waste. The fast air conditioning of the alloy within the mold results in a strengthened part that typically requires little to no added machining.
Die casting is especially useful for high-volume production runs, where consistency and speed are vital. It supports the creation of complex geometries, making it appropriate for numerous applications, consisting of automotive, aerospace, and durable goods.
In addition, the process can accommodate numerous aluminum alloys, enhancing the mechanical residential properties of the completed products. With its capability to produce light-weight yet resilient elements, die casting sticks out as a preferred strategy in modern-day manufacturing, supplying both precision and efficiency in aluminum casting.
Financial Investment Casting: Information and Intricacy
Financial investment casting, likewise called lost-wax casting, is a versatile and exact technique for generating complicated aluminum components. This method is particularly valued for its capacity to create complex geometries and fine information that are commonly unattainable with various other casting approaches. The process starts with a wax pattern, which is covered in a ceramic shell. Once the shell solidifies, the wax is disappeared, leaving a detailed mold and mildew for aluminum putting.
The advantages of financial investment casting include remarkable surface coating and dimensional accuracy, lessening the demand for substantial machining afterward. It is particularly useful for tiny to medium manufacturing runs where precision is crucial. This approach fits numerous aluminum alloys, improving its applicability throughout markets. aluminum casting. Eventually, financial investment casting stands apart for its capacity to provide both visual appeal and practical efficiency in aluminum elements, making it a recommended choice for designers and designers seeking complicated options

Choosing the Right Technique for Your Task
Exactly how can one figure out the most ideal aluminum casting method for a certain project? The selection process rests on numerous important factors, including the intricacy of the design, the desired surface finish, and manufacturing volume demands. For detailed designs, financial investment casting typically proves beneficial as a result of its capability to record fine information. On the other hand, sand casting may be liked for bigger, much less intricate components, providing cost-efficiency and adaptability in production.
Factors to consider relating to tolerances and mechanical homes of the final item are essential. For high-performance elements, die casting might be the finest choice, as it provides exceptional dimensional precision and surface quality. Furthermore, comprehending the material buildings and compatibility with the picked technique is essential for making certain the success of the job. Ultimately, a thorough analysis of these variables will lead the decision-making process, bring about one of the most effective aluminum casting method for the details task at hand.
